A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

© 清凉 中级黑马   /  2016-7-1 13:58  /  824 人查看  /  13 人回复  /   0 人收藏 转载请遵从CC协议 禁止商业使用本文

学到数组了,但是始终对数组不太理解

13 个回复

倒序浏览
只有理解数组就是一个容器,就能明白设计数组的意义
回复 使用道具 举报
如果你有一组类似的数据,一个个起名字麻烦也没意义,用个数组保存它们,用起来就方便一点。
回复 使用道具 举报
存放多个数据的容器
回复 使用道具 举报
实际上是个容器.以后深入学习就会知道其用处的
回复 使用道具 举报
shuiwa 来自手机 中级黑马 2016-7-1 22:34:44
地板
可以通过角标索引很多东西
回复 使用道具 举报
我理解就是个容器
回复 使用道具 举报
由原来操作单个常量,改成操作一个集合 在开发一些程序的时候,会对一些数据进行分类 (数据库)
回复 使用道具 举报
由原来操作单个常量,改成操作一个集合 在开发一些程序的时候,会对一些数据进行分类 (数据库)
回复 使用道具 举报
本帖最后由 feng19900123 于 2016-7-1 23:49 编辑

数组使用过程中一般都会用到循环操作,他可以存储相同类型的数据,且只需一个名字加索引就访问该元素,这将在有庞大数据项目中很方边,如果使用其他数据类型,变量数量就会很多!
回复 使用道具 举报
数组其实就是 一个容器(container),它就是一个储存数据的地方,可以存储不同的数据,比如int(整型数据),double(双精度),还有String类型等,一个数组一旦创建它的大小就不能改变,数组里的数据类型必须是一致的,同一种数据类型,不能有不同的类型存储在同一个数组中,数组遍历使用循环将数组中的元素打印出来,从0角标开始访问,最大元素的角标为list.length-1,而显示数组的大小为数组名称.length,数组分为一维数组,二维数组,多维数组。二维数组遍历用到循环嵌套(for  for),二位数组多以表格形式出现。数组里还有一个是对象数组,大体和其他数组的差不多,但是遍历时候需要创建对象如:Person[] list = new Person[n]
回复 使用道具 举报
就是担心起名字起不过来,所以就是搞个容器,把这些数据放到一起而已
回复 使用道具 举报
如果你有一组类似的数据 ,一个个起名字很麻烦也没意义,用个数组保存他们,用起来就方便一点
回复 使用道具 举报
存储多个同类型的数据
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马